Port Vue-area historical tornado activity is slightly above Pennsylvania state average. It is 11%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 6/3/1980,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 22.8 miles away from the Port Vue borough center injured 140 people and caused between $50,000,000 and $500,000,000 in damages.

On 8/3/1963, a category 3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 1.4 miles away from the borough center killed 2 people and injured 70 people and caused between $5,000,000 and $50,000,000 in damages.


Port Vue-area historical earthquake activity is significantly below Pennsylvania state average. It is 99%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 9/25/1998 at 19:52:52, a magnitude 5.2 (4.8 MB, 4.3 MS, 5.2 LG, 4.5 MW, Depth: 3.1 mi, Class: Moderate, Intensity: VI - VII) earthquake occurred 84.3 miles away from Port Vue center
Magnitude types: regional Lg-wave magnitude (LG), body-wave magnitude (MB), surface-wave magnitude (MS), moment magnitude (MW)
